2014 has really been the first year when there’s been enough new contenders to actually discuss it properly as a category, and certainly the first year where those contenders have started genuinely hitting the same marks as their combustion-engined counterparts. Such has been the change in the market, we’ve even said goodbye to some – the Vauxhall Ampera and Chevrolet Volt, to name two. So which are the real performers?

5) The VW E-Up! – Compact city car, perfectly suited to electric tech.

4) BMW i3 – a standalone electric model, excellent to drive but hampered by real world practicality

3) The VW GTE – class-leading hatchback in performance, electric form. Practical, cheap to run, and quick.

2) The Audi A3 e-tron – Audi’s version of the Golf GTE – every bit as excellent, a little more refined.

1) The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V – a 7 seat SUV that can do 155mpg, is exempt from car tax, and emits just 49g/km of CO2.
